Farewell
With sorrow falling on me now
I trace your initials on the glass
So frozen in my solitude
And cringing at all needy tasks
Your face has crawled up to the moon
To glow with messages profound
First looking at me as to speak
Then never uttering a sound
All other yearnings are hollowed cold
My figuring has all run dry
Persevering has grown old
I simply shut my eyes and sigh
And there my piano beckons me
I often see it turn to dust
Then blow away the powdered tunes
Haunting refrains roll into crust
So shaken in this pattern of
Your words that still speak of our dreams
And though I’ve sewed it to look new
You fray it and rest in the seams
Hanging higher, you’re smiling now
There inside my solemn impressions
Farewell, my love, I long for sleep
And I shall toss with that intention
